Catalogue import for the Bramfield Athenaeum keeps dropping mid-run — worker logs show timeouts after ~40k records, then the pool just gives up. Suspect the importer is opening a fresh connection per batch. Can you bump the pool cap and retry the Tuesday snapshot? To reproduce, run the importer locally against the staging database using the string below.

primary connection of yagep-kahip = redis://giliel_svc:zYiKsLL2PLpfPL@db-348f.xolmarsys.corp:5432/fenwyn

Handover: Nightroller scheduler (backfills). Jobs fan out per-dataset; don't raise concurrency past what the warehouse pool allows or Tilda's ingestion jobs starve. Failed partitions retry thrice then park in the dead queue — drain it Mondays. Cron definitions live in the repo, runtime knobs do not. Current production values are pinned as shown below.

settings of fafog-haduf:
ZORIX_PIN=4648
ZORIX_METRICS_HOST=metrics.zorix.paliqsys.corp
ZORIX_LOG_LEVEL=info
ZORIX_TENANT=druix

Team,

The Tracewell service key rotates tonight at 02:00 UTC. This key signs trace-context headers propagated across the Lumenport microservices, so stale keys will break span stitching in the Oakhollow dashboard. Update your local tooling before the cutover; old keys are revoked immediately after. Escalate stitching failures to the platform channel.

The new Tracewell key is below.

— Platform Ops

app token of yajeg-kawef = kto11_7En3XSX8xQw

**Ticket: Re-enable retry for failed exports (NightLedger)**

Support team: customers on the Brindlemoor plan are reporting that failed CSV exports stay stuck in "errored" with no retry option. We propose restoring the automatic three-attempt retry with exponential backoff, plus a manual "Retry export" button in the admin panel. Please verify the workaround script is no longer circulated once this ships, and update the macro accordingly. This change cannot be deployed without explicit sign-off from the person named below.

named custodian: Brivan Eliath Quenox Frador